The Ellwood City Area School District’s Board of Directors approved numerous matters regarding personnel for summer employment and programs and also for the 2025-2026 school year during their May meeting.
They accepted the resignation and release agreement of employee #1727 effective April 25, 2025. The board would not release the name of the employee. District Superintendent Wesley Shipley said the district is unable to announce a name.
The board also hired a full-time custodian and approved summer cafeteria workers (Stephanie Borroni, Debra Lewis, Jennifer Greco, and Brandi Lippman as a substitute), 2025 Summer Academy K-6 elementary teachers and aides for the Summer Learning and Enrichment Program List 1 List 2 , and a request from the Technology Department to hire up to 2 student Interns to work no more than 28 hours a week per student at $10.00 per hour to assist/learn technology implementation.

Motions passed:
- Motion to approve minutes from the April 7, 2025 Committee Meeting and April 10, 2025 Regular Meeting.
- Motion to approve the 2025-2026 Lawrence County Career and Technical Center Budget in the amount of $7,484,155 with no increase from last year.
- Motion to approve the 2025-2026 Proposed Preliminary General Fund Budget as presented.
- Motion to approve the PA School Boards Association (PSBA) All Access Membership package for the 2025-26 school year at a cost of $11,675.00.
- Motion to appoint Mrs. Erica Gray as Treasurer for the school district for the 2025-2026 school year beginning July 1, 2025 through June 30, 2026 in accordance with Section 404 of the School Code of Pennsylvania that requires the school directors annually, during the month of May, appoint a treasurer to serve for a one year term beginning the first day of July.

- Motion to approve the Transportation Contract with the Portersville Christian School for the 2025-26 school year at a cost of $144 per day for a total of $26,064 per year shared with the Riverside Beaver County School District, a $543.00 increase from last year.
